Yesterday MSI officially announced its new laptop and published the list of its specifications. MSI GT660 is positioned as the world’s most high-powered laptop. It is equipped with 1.6 GHz Intel Core i7-720QM processor, 12 GB DDR2 RAM, Nvidia GeForce GTX 285M with 1 GB built-in memory, two hard drives (up to 1.2 TB), DVD or Blu-ray optic drive, cardreader, Wi-Fi, 1.3 Mp webcam, HDMI, USB 3.0. This laptop also has rubber keyboard and orange LED illumination. Besides MSI GT660 features TDE and ECO Engine technologies that provide longer battery life. There are also two loudspeakers and subwoofer. The operating system is Windows 7 Home Premium or Windows 7 Ultimate. Unfortunately MSI has not published any information about price yet.

HTC has just unveiled its new smartphone running on Google Android 2.1 operating system with HTC Sense user interface. It is positioned as affordable high-end mobile device designed for younger audience. As many other device of such class HTC Wildfire integrates the most popular social networks featuring Friend Stream application that gathers and displays content from social networks like Facebook, Twitter, and Flickr into one organized stream of updates. As for technical specifications HTC Wildfire has 528 MHz Qualcomm MSM7225 processor, 384 Mb RAM, MicroSD external memory card slot, 3.2 inch multi-touch capable screen with 320×240px resolution, 5 Mp camera with autofocus and LED flash, GPS, Bluetooth, Wi-Fi. HTC Wildfire is expected to be available in the begging of September.

At last LG Electronics together with Verizon Wireless mobile operator officially announced its new affordable smartphone. LG Ally is horizontal slider with full QWERTY keyboard. The main feature of this device is ergonomic design, special screen covering made of tempered glass, tactile feedback support,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n module, advanced media player. It is also know that LG Ally runs on Google Android 2.1 operating system and is equipped with 600 MHz Qualcomm MSM7627 processor, 256 MB RAM, 512 MB ROM 3.2 inch capacitive multi-touch screen with 480×800px resolution, 3.2 Mp camera with autofocus and flash, Bluetooth 2.1 with A2DP, GPS, 3.5mm headphones jack. Supported network standards are CDMA/1xEV-DO rev.A 800/1900 MHz. The dimensions are 115.8×56.4×15.7mm, the weight is 157.9g. LG Ally will be released in a week and will cost $100 with two-year contract.

T-Mobile has just unveiled new smartphone that will become available in its shops next month. The producer of this device is Taiwanese HTC. T-Mobile myTouch 3G Slide is horizontal QWERTY slider running on Google Android 2.1 operating system with HTC Sense UI. This device features such custom pre-installed apps including the “Faves Gallery” - a social aggregator, “myModes” - a profile manager that can change the phone’s themes and settings depending on current time or location, and the Swype keyboard. There is also “Genius Button” that allows to do just about anything on the phone using voice, hear messages read back to you and etc. The list of technical specification includes 3.4 inch touchscreen with 320×480px resolution and 65K colors, 5 Mp camera with autofocus and flash, 512 Mb internal storage, MicroSD external card slot, Wi-Fi (802.11b/g), Bluetooth 2.0 with A2DP, GPS, compass, accelerometer, motion sensor. Supported network standards are GSM 850/900/1800/1900 MHz, UMTS/HSDPA 1700/2100 MHz. T-Mobile myTouch 3G Slide measures 116×60x15mm and weights 164g.

Chinese Aigo company released is almost ready to release its new tablet computer running on Google Android 2.1 operating system. According to some unofficial sources Aigo N700 is based on Nvidia Tegra 2 platform and is equipped with 1 GHz processor, 7 inch multi-touch capable screen with 800×480px resolution, 512 Mb DDR2 RAM (667 MHz), 4 Gb or 32Gb internal memory, MicroSD external memory card slot, 1.3 Mp camera for video calls, accelerometer, GPS, digital compass, ambient light sensor, 3.5mm headphones jack, USB 2.0 port, HDMI output. Wireless connectivity includes Wi-Fi, Bluetooth and optional 3G module. It also notable that this tablets supports HD video (1080p) playback. The dimensions are 208×122x14mm, the weight is 465g. Unfortunately we have no any official information about release date and price.

Samsung I9000 Galaxy S is flagship smartphone running on Google Android 2.1 operating system. It features 4 inch Super AMOLED multi-touch screen with 800×480px resolution, 1 GHz processor, 5 Mp camera with autofocus and HD video (720p) recording support. Other specifications are Bluetooth 3.0 with A2DP, Wi-Fi 802.11b/g/n, GPS, 8 GB or 16 Gb internal storage, MicroSD external memory card slot (up to 32 GB), frontal VGA camera for video calls, accelerometer, digital compass, motion sensor, 3.5mm headphones jack, 1500 mAh battery. Samsung I9000 Galaxy S measures 122.4×64.2×9.9mm and weights 118g.

T-Mobile operator together with Garmin announced new smartphone featuring impressive navigation capabilities. T-Mobile Garminfone is a version of Garmin Nuvifone A50. It runs on Google Android 1.6 operating system and is equipped with 3.5 inch capacitive multi-touch capable screen with 320×480px resolution, 3 Mp camera with autofocus, 4 Gb built-in storage, microSD memory card slot (up to 32 Gb), Wi-Fi 802.11b/g, Bluetooth 2.0 with A2DP, accelerometer digital compass, GPS module. The battery has 1150 mAh capacity and provides up to 3 hours of talk time or 250 hours of idle one. Naturally though the Garminfone’s speciality is the fully-functioning navigation features which include driving, walking and public transportation directions - whether in or out of network coverage. There’s the option of using lane guidance when driving too. It also includes several pre-installed Garmin apps that provide info on local petrol prices, real-time traffic, weather, local events and movie listings. There is no information about price. The release will take place in next few weeks.
Chinese Moonse has just unveiled its new device – Moonse E-7001. It is tablet running on Google Android 1.6 operating system. Its list of specifications includes 7 inch touch screen with 800×400px resolution, 600 MHz Rockchip RK2808 processor, microSD memory card slot (up to 32 Gb), 1.3 Mp webcam, WiFi 802.11b/g, 3G HDSPA modem, Bluetooth, two Mini-USB ports, 3.5mm headphones jack. The battery has 3000 mAh capacity and provides about 5 hours of active work time. This tablets measures 237×125x14.33mm and weights 400g. The price is about $135.
